I tried that on a few recycling centres that I know, but I hit a snag. On finding the relevant centre in OpenWasteMap, I can see the link to the website, but following it (in most cases) gives an HTTP 404 error. I notice that the URL has "%7D" at the end, which was not on the URL that I put in the tag. Deleting "%7D" in the browser address bar gives the correct page.</div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false"><br></div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false">So, is OWM adding "%7D" ? </div><div><br></div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false">To see an example, look at any of the 3 centres in Milton Keynes, (e.g. <a href="https://www.openstreetmap.org/way/376539761#map=19/52.08169/-0.70595" rel="nofollow" target="_blank" fg_scanned="1">https://www.openstreetmap.org/way/376539761#map=19/52.08169/-0.70595</a> )</div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false"><br></div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false">I don't think it is all my fault; Beaconsfield and St Albans Centres have the same issue.</div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false"><br></div><div class="ydpdd362c8csignature"><div style="font-family:new times, serif;font-size:16px;"><div>Regards,</div><div dir="ltr">Peter</div><div dir="ltr" data-setdir="false">(PeterPan99)</div></div></div></div><div><br></div><div><br></div>
